本文分类:news发布日期:2025/6/15 12:46:37
相关文章
仿点评项目—项目总结
文章目录 一、登录1、实现登录拦截功能2、session共享问题3、Redis代替session的业务流程4、基于Redis实现短信登录5、双拦截器解决状态登录刷新问题 二、商户查询缓存1、缓存模型和思路2、缓存更新策略3、数据库缓存不一致解决方案4、双写一致性扩展:延迟双删 5、实…
建站知识
2025/6/10 13:29:30
helm的go模板语法学习
1、helm chart
1.0、什么是helm?
介绍:就是个包管理器。理解为java的maven、linux的yum就好。 安装方法也可参见官网: https://helm.sh/docs/intro/install
通过前面的演示我们知道,有了helm之后应用的安装、升级、查看、停止都…
建站知识
2025/6/6 3:48:46
多角度分析Vue3 nextTick() 函数
nextTick() 是 Vue 3 中的一个核心函数,它的作用是延迟执行某些操作,直到下一次 DOM 更新循环结束之后再执行。这个函数常用于在 Vue 更新 DOM 后立即获取更新后的 DOM 状态,或者在组件渲染完成后执行某些操作。
官方的解释是,当…
建站知识
2025/6/15 3:00:37
分享:批量提取图片文字并自动命名文件,ocr识别图片指定区域并重命名文件名工具,基于WPF和腾讯OCR识别的接口的视线方案
一、项目背景
在处理大量图片时,常常需要从图片中提取特定区域的文字信息,并依据这些信息对图片进行重命名。例如,在档案管理领域,大量纸质文件被扫描成图片后,需要从图片中提取关键信息(如文件编号、日期等)来重命名图片,以便后续的检索和管理;在电商领域,商家可能…
建站知识
2025/6/6 12:55:18
系统架构设计师:系统架构概述案例分析与简答题、详细解析与评分要点
10道系统架构概述知识体系案例分析与简答题,涵盖架构设计原则、质量属性、演化过程、评估方法等核心考点,并附详细解析与评分要点: 一、案例分析题(5题)
1. 电商系统高并发场景下的架构设计
背景:某电商平…
建站知识
2025/6/12 16:13:28
C#中async await异步关键字用法和异步的底层原理
目录 C#异步编程一、异步编程基础二、异步方法的工作原理三、代码示例四、编译后的底层实现五、总结 C#异步编程
一、异步编程基础
异步编程是啥玩意儿 就是让程序在干等着某些耗时操作(比如等网络响应、读写文件啥的)的时候,能把线程腾出来…
建站知识
2025/6/6 6:27:03
Avalonia开发实践(六)——实现Breadcrumb(面包屑)控件
引言
面包屑控件是在单窗体应用中常用的一种控件,用来指示当前页面的路由信息,以及提供导航功能。本文将完整地呈现一个面包屑控件的诞生过程。
一、面包屑控件的结构
面包屑控件由一个主体Breadcrumb和内部的BreadcrumbItem集合组成,这种…
建站知识
2025/6/15 5:32:31